Change: Timing changes to route 50. Introduction of new services 55, 55A and 55B which will run as the 50 as far as RAF Halton then extend to Chesham
- Service 55 will run 1 early morning and 1 evening trip each way travelling via Great Missenden.
- Service 55A and 55B will replace withdrawn services 149/194 and serve Tring, Wiggington and Cholesbury. 55B will additionally serve Bellingdon and St Leonards.
Starting: 15 September 2025

Change: The route 50 timetable will be improved with buses running up to every 2 hours on Monday to Saturday and additional buses between Newton Longville and Bletchley. This will work with new routes 51 and 70. Route 51 will run up to every 2 hours Monday to Saturday and connect Milton Keynes, Newton Longville and Bletchley. Route 70 will provide a new Monday to Friday peak time service between Swanbourne, The Horwoods and Winslow. Route 50 and 70 buses will serve Winslow Station when this becomes operational.
Starting: 6 October 2025
